RESUME: Mission - Lyon, France

  1. The City of Lyon
    1. Founded in 43 B.C. by order of Julius Caesar
    2. Today 2nd-largest city in France: pop. 1.6 million (inc. suburbs)
    3. A crossroads for all Europe
  2. Church History in Lyon
    1. Ancient history: Irenaeus : an elder in Lyon in the 2nd century
    2. Modern history
      May 1975 - Arlin & Judy Hendrix and Max Dauner began the work in Lyon.
      April 1977 - Max married the former Prisca Daugherty.
      August 1982 - Mike & Karen Mason came to help the Lyon mission. In 1986, they moved to Nantes, France.
      July 1984 - Max & Monique Lanoix, converted in Lyon in 1981, moved to Guadeloupe (French Caribbean) and started a congregation.
      September 1984 - Barry & Rachel Baggott arrived to work for 2 years with the Hendrixes. (They then worked as missionaries in Ivory Coast for 15 years.)
      September 1986 - Scott Harris & Jeff Wilson arrived to work 2 years with the church. (Scott & his wife Lisa later worked as missionaries in Togo, West Africa, and they now work in South Africa.)
      October 1987 - Charles & Pam White moved from Grenoble to Lyon.
      January 1988 - Judy Hendrix died of cancer.
      December 1988 - Arlin Hendrix married the former Pamela Whitesell.
      April 1989 - Max & Prisca Dauner moved to help the mission in Montpellier, France.
      August 2001 - Archie & Mandy Chankin and Andy & Melissa Johnson arrived for 1 year of language study. (They are presently missionaries in Burkina Faso, West Africa.)
      January 2002 - Aaron & Andrea Burk arrived for 4 months of language study. (They are presently missionaries in Burkina Faso, West Africa.)
      August 2003 - Chad & Amy Carter arrived for 6 months of language study. (They are presently missionaries in Burkina Faso, West Africa.)
      September 2004 - Katie Kelly arrived for 2 years as a missions apprentice.
